The relations existing between convent schools and the systems of intermediate and primary national education

Decorative border on t.p. -- printed by Browne & Nolan, Nassau Street. -- 'One shilling' stated on t.p. -- Dedicated to the Most Eminent and Rev. Henry Edward Cardinal Manning, Archbishop of Westminster.
